Wheel Hubs and Bearings In contemporary Dodge Ram trucks (such as the Ram 1500, 2500, and 3500), the wheel bearing and hub are normally sold as a single sealed system.Since these trucks are frequently used for heavy towing and transporting, the center assemblies withstand incredible lateral and vertical loads. Front vs. Rear: Four-wheel-drive( 4WD)and two-wheel-drive( 2WD )models have distinct hub configurations. 4WD designs include front center assemblies that must also accommodate the axle shaft and CV joints. Can I change just the wheel bearing, or do I require the whole center assembly? On the majority of modern Dodge Ram trucks, the wheel bearing is pushed into the center assembly at the factory as a non-serviceable sealed system. For that reason, guideline is to replace the entire wheel center assembly rather than just the bearing itself. 4. Why do factory Dodge Ram Parts And Accessories Ram lug nuts swell?
